一种安全保护方法和系统技术方案

技术编号:15063419 阅读:151 留言:0更新日期:2017-04-06 12:15
本发明专利技术提供了一种安全保护方法和系统,应用于与第一终端近场通信连接的用户终端,涉及信息安全技术领域。本发明专利技术实施例中,用户终端获取第一终端的序列码信息,作为加密元数据,再通过加密算法对加密元数据进行加密,生成加密秘钥,然后,通过加密秘钥对待加密文件进行加密,得到加密文件,并将加密文件按照指定路径进行保存。本发明专利技术利用近场通信技术,通过近场通信终端对用户终端中的个人信息进行加密,能够有效提高个人信息的安全性。

【技术实现步骤摘要】

本专利技术涉及信息安全
,具体而言,涉及一种安全保护方法和系统
技术介绍
随着智能手机、IPAD等各种终端设备的不断普及,终端信息安全也变得愈加重要。通常情况下,采用手势、数字等密码对终端上的某些数据、文件进行加密,以保证个人隐私的安全性。经专利技术人研究发现,如此的加密方式容易导致密码泄露,从而致使加密数据丢失或密码忘记,而不能得到解密后的信息。
技术实现思路
本专利技术旨在改善上述的技术问题。为此,本专利技术提供一种安全保护方法和系统,旨在进一步提高终端数据的安全性。本专利技术较佳实施例提供一种安全保护方法,应用于与第一终端近场通信连接的用户终端,所述方法包括:获取第一终端的序列码信息,作为加密元数据;通过加密算法对所述加密元数据进行加密,生成加密秘钥;通过所述加密秘钥对待加密文件进行加密,得到加密文件,并将所述加密文件按照指定路径进行保存。本专利技术另一较佳实施例提供一种安全保护系统,应用于与第一终端近场通信连接的用户终端,所述系统包括第一信息获取模块、第一秘钥生成模块和加密模块:所述第一信息获取模块,用于获取第一终端的序列码信息,作为加密元数据;所述第一秘钥生成模块,用于通过加密算法对所述加密元数据进行加密,得到加密秘钥;所述加密模块,用于通过所述加密秘钥对待加密文件进行加密,得到加密文件,并将所述加密文件按照指定路径进行保存。与现有技术相比,本专利技术实施例提供的一种安全保护方法和系统,利用近场通信技术,通过近场通信终端对用户终端中的个人信息进行加密。能够有效避免现有技术中,密码容易泄露、丢失等带来的一系列问题,同时也进一步提高了终端数据的安全性。为使本专利技术的上述目的、特征和优点能更明显易懂,下文特举较佳实施例,并配合所附附图,作详细说明如下。附图说明为了更清楚地说明本专利技术实施例的技术方案,下面将对实施例中所需要使用的附图作简单地介绍,应当理解,以下附图仅示出了本专利技术的某些实施例,因此不应被看作是对范围的限定,对于本领域普通技术人员来讲,在不付出创造性劳动的前提下,还可以根据这些附图获得其他相关的附图。图1为本专利技术较佳实施例提供的安全保护系统的结构框图。图2为安全保护系统的加密功能单元的结构框图。图3为安全保护系统的解密功能单元的结构框图。图4为本专利技术较佳实施例提供的安全保护方法中的加密流程图。图5为本专利技术较佳实施例提供的安全保护方法中的解密流程图。图标:10-用户终端;102-第一选择模块;104-第一判断模块;106-第二判断模块;108-第一信息获取模块;110-第一秘钥生成模块;112-加密模块;114-第三判断模块;116-第二选择模块;118-第二信息获取模块;120-第二秘钥生成模块;122-秘钥匹配模块;20-第一终端;30-第二终端。具体实施方式下面将结合本专利技术实施例中附图,对本专利技术实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例仅仅是本专利技术一部分实施例,而不是全部的实施例。通常在此处附图中描述和示出的本专利技术实施例的组件可以以各种不同的配置来布置和设计。因此,以下对在附图中提供的本专利技术的实施例的详细描述并非旨在限制要求保护的本专利技术的范围,而是仅仅表示本专利技术的选定实施例。基于本专利技术的实施例,本领域技术人员在没有做出创造性劳动的前提下所获得的所有其他实施例,都属于本专利技术保护的范围。应注意到:相似的标号和字母在下面的附图中表示类似项,因此,一旦某一项在一个附图中被定义,则在随后的附图中不需要对其进行进一步定义和解释。同时,在本专利技术的描述中,除非另有明确的规定和限定,术语“安装”、“设置”、“连接”应做广义理解,例如,可以是固定连接,也可以是可拆卸连接,或一体地连接;可以是机械连接,也可以是电连接;可以是直接相连,也可以通过中间媒介间接相连,可以是两个元件内部的连通。对于本领域的普通技术人员而言,可以具体情况理解上述术语在本专利技术中的具体含义。请参阅图1,为本专利技术实施例提供的一种安全保护系统框图。所述安全保护系统应用于用户终端10,所述用户终端10与第一终端20和第二终端30近场通信(NearFieldCommunication,NFC)连接。其中,所述近场通信是一种短距高频的无线电技术,在10厘米距离内能够以13.56MHz的频率运行,其传输速度有106Kbit/秒、212Kbit/秒或者424Kbit/秒三种。目前,近场通信已成为ISO/IECIS18092国际标准、ECMA-340标准与ETSITS102190标准。可选地,近场通信设备信息可以采用主动和被动两种读取模式。可选地,所述用户终端10可以采用Android、IOS、BlackBerry或者其他能够支持所述近场通信应用的其他操作系统。本专利技术实施例采用安装有Android系统的用户终端10。可选地,所述第一终端20和所述第二终端30可以为日常生活中,常见的NFC卡片,如公交卡、门禁卡等,也可以为具有NFC功能的移动终端等。在本专利技术实施例中,进行文件加密和解密时,只读取所述第一终端20或所述第二终端30的序列码信息,不会获取或者写入任何其他信息,以保证该用户终端20的使用者的安全。进一步地,请参阅图2,为本专利技术实施例的安全保护系统的加密功能单元结构框图。在对文件进行加密的过程中,所述系统包括第一选择模块102、第一判断模块104、第二判断模块106、第一信息获取模块108、第一秘钥生成模块110和加密模块112。所述第一选择模块102用于选取用户隐私文件。可选地,所述第一选择模块102可为所述用户终端10中的操作系统自带的文件浏览器。所述第一判断模块104用于判断所述用户隐私文件是否存在,若存在,则对所述用户隐私文件进行标记,并作为待加密文件。所述第一判断模块104还用于判断所述用户隐私文件的类型是否为指定类型,若为指定类型,则作为待加密文件。可选地,除过上述所述第一判断模块104用于先后判断所述用户隐私文件是否存在和所述用户隐私文件的类型是否为指定类型之外,所述第一判断模块104也可以单独用于判断所述用户隐私文件是否存在,或单独用于判断所述用户隐私文件的类型是否为指定类型。所述第二判断模块106用于判断所述用户终端10是否支持所述第一终端20信息的读取,若所述用户终端10支持所述第一终端20信息的读取,则读取所述第一终端20的序列码信息。所述第一信息获取模块108用于获取第一终端20的序列码信息,作为加密元数据。具体地,所述第一信息获取模块108首先获取所述第一终端20的数据信息,然后对所述数据信息进行过滤提取,从而得到所述序列码信息,以作为加密元数据。所述第一秘钥生成模块110用于通过加密算法对所述加密元数据进行加密,得到加密秘钥。可选地,对所述加密元数据进行加密时,可以选取一种或者多种不同的加密算法,其中,本专利技术实施例采用MD5加密算法对所述加密元数据进行加密。所述加密模块112用于通过所述加密秘钥对待加密文件进行加密,得到加密文件,并将所述加密文件按照指定路径进行保存。可选地,所述安全保护系统在进行文件加密时,还包括第三判断模块114,所述第三判断模块114用于选取所述加密文件的存放地址,并判断所述存放地址的存储空间是否足够,以及选取的目标存放地址是否为指定类型。进一步地,请参阅图3,为本专利技术实施例的安本文档来自技高网...
一种安全保护方法和系统

【技术保护点】
一种安全保护方法,应用于与第一终端近场通信连接的用户终端,其特征在于,所述方法包括:获取第一终端的序列码信息,作为加密元数据;通过加密算法对所述加密元数据进行加密,生成加密秘钥;通过所述加密秘钥对待加密文件进行加密,得到加密文件,并将所述加密文件按照指定路径进行保存。

【技术特征摘要】
1.一种安全保护方法,应用于与第一终端近场通信连接的用户终端,其特征在于,所述方法包括:获取第一终端的序列码信息,作为加密元数据;通过加密算法对所述加密元数据进行加密,生成加密秘钥;通过所述加密秘钥对待加密文件进行加密,得到加密文件,并将所述加密文件按照指定路径进行保存。2.根据权利要求1所述的安全保护方法,其特征在于,在所述获取第一终端的序列码信息的步骤之前,所述方法还包括:选取用户隐私文件;判断所述用户隐私文件是否存在,若存在,则对所述用户隐私文件进行标记,并作为待加密文件。3.根据权利要求1所述的安全保护方法,其特征在于,在所述获取第一终端的序列码信息的步骤之前,所述方法还包括:选取用户隐私文件;判断所述用户隐私文件的类型是否为指定类型,若为指定类型,则所述用户隐私文件作为待加密文件。4.根据权利要求1所述的安全保护方法,其特征在于,在所述获取第一终端的序列码信息的步骤之前,所述方法还包括:判断所述用户终端是否支持所述第一终端信息的读取;若所述用户终端支持所述第一终端信息的读取,则读取所述第一终端的序列码信息。5.根据权利要求1所述的安全保护方法,所述用户终端还可以与第二终端近场通信,其特征在于,所述方法还包括:选取待解密文件;获取所述第二终端的序列码信息,作为解密元数据;使用所述加密算法对所述解密元数据进行加密,得到解密秘钥;将所述解密秘钥与所述加密秘钥进行匹配,若匹配成功,则打开所述待解密文件。6.一种安全保护系统,应用于与第一终端近场通信连接的用户终端,其特征在于,所述系统包括第一信息获取模块、第一秘钥生...

【专利技术属性】
技术研发人员:丁鹏
申请(专利权)人:武汉斗鱼网络科技有限公司
类型:发明
国别省市:湖北;42

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1